Amazon has 5-Count Square 2" #2 Drive Impact Tough Screw Bits (ITSQ2205) for $3.99. Shipping is free w/ Prime or on orders of $25+.

Thanks to Deal Editor iconian for finding this deal.

Available:Product Features:
  • 10x life over standard impact bits
  • Xtended torsion zone helps to absorb high-torque of new impact drivers
  • Precision-engineered tips for a tighter fit and less CAM out
  • Heat-treated manufacturing for stronger bit
  • High-visibility sleeve with laser-etched markings for user convenience

You definitely need these for projects. I just bought a two pack of DeWalt ones from Lowe's a few days ago thanks to the suggestion of the guy there for a garage project I was doing. I was using that cheap standard one that came with my Craftsman impact driver I bought and had snapped a few screw heads off. I am wondering now if that bit that came with it was the problem. I don't understand why when then sell these things they don't come with at least one of these types of bits, they are worth what, $2 at retail, just seems like a shitty thing to do to your customers, especially someone like me that never had an impact driver before. I screwed in about 20 screws with the proper #2 bit I got and not a single snapped screw head.
